Landmarks to Explore

Florence: City Highlights and Street Food Walking Tour - Landmarks to Explore

Wandering through Florence, visitors encounter breathtaking landmarks like the majestic Duomo and the bustling Piazza della Repubblica, each telling a story of the city’s rich history.

The Duomo’s stunning dome, designed by Brunelleschi, invites awe and admiration, while a stroll through Piazza della Repubblica reveals vibrant street performers and charming cafés.

Don’t miss Piazza della Signoria, where the grandeur of the Palazzo Vecchio stands tall, offering a glimpse into Florence’s political past. It’s a great spot to pause and soak in the atmosphere.

Many travelers recommend taking a moment to enjoy a gelato while admiring these sites—it’s a quintessential Florentine experience!

Exploring these landmarks provides a deeper appreciation for Florence’s artistic and cultural heritage.

Dietary Restrictions and Considerations

Florence: City Highlights and Street Food Walking Tour - Dietary Restrictions and Considerations

Navigating dietary restrictions in Florence’s vibrant food scene can be a bit tricky, but with the right information, everyone can enjoy the local flavors.

For vegetarians, it’s advisable to inform your guide ahead of time; they can often provide tasty options.

However, those with gluten or lactose intolerances may find it challenging, as many traditional dishes contain these ingredients.
